以下のような記事を書きましたが、今回はその別解。
ubuntuでrfriendsを2つ実行する。
https://rfriends.hatenablog.com/entry/2021/07/08/205928
多分、というか絶対に今回のやり方のほうがスマートでわかりやすいと思います。
前提
・user
・usrdir = "/home/user/usr/"
で、rfriendsが正常動作している。
今回
・user2
・usrdir = "/home/user2/usr/"
を追加する。
1.ユーザ登録
$ sudo adduser user2
$ sudo gpasswd -a user2 sudo
2.ディレクトリ作成
user2でログインし、
$ cd
$ mkdir usr
3.rfriendsのインストール
php,ffmeg等のアプリは1つ目ですでにインストール済なので不要です。
$ cd
$ wget http://rfriends.s1009.xrea.com/files/rfriends2_latest_script.zip
$ unzip rfriends2_latest_script.zip
4.rfriendsの起動
$ cd
$ cd rfriends2
$ sh rfriends2.sh
5.設定
usrdirの設定やデイリー処理等、1つ目のユーザを気にすることなく設定できます。
6.sambaの設定
$ sudo vi /etc/samba/smb.conf
[smbdir2]
comment = rfriends user2
path = /home/user2/usr
read only = no
guest ok = no
force user = user2
$ sudo service smbd restart
7.その他
いかがでしたか?
このほうが簡単ですよね。
以上